Five Discourses on Positive Religion is a book written by John Henry Bridges and published in 1882. The book is a collection of five essays that explore the concept of positive religion, which is defined as a religion that is based on reason and evidence rather than blind faith. The essays cover a range of topics, including the nature of God, the role of religion in society, and the relationship between religion and science. Bridges argues that positive religion is essential for the moral and intellectual development of individuals and society as a whole. He also emphasizes the importance of reason and critical thinking in the practice of religion.
